Banmankhi Bazar
Banmankhi Bazar is a locality in Banmankhi, Purnia, Bihar and has about 30,300 residents. Banmankhi Bazar is situated nearby to the locality Chakla, as well as near Dhokardhāra.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Banmankhi Junction railway station
Railway station
Photo: Abhinav Walker, CC BY 4.0.
Banmankhi Junction railway station, is the railway station serving the town of Banmankhi in the Purnea district in the Indian state of Bihar. It is a NSG-4 category railway station of Samastipur railway division in East Central Railway.
